Latest Patents

Lima's latest patents include "Systems and methods for dynamic dimming of a set of displays sharing a single energy source." This invention involves receiving image data from an external camera of a vehicle to determine the light intensity and angle of an external light source. Based on this data, a desired brightness level is generated, allowing for the adjustment of display brightness according to the driver's gaze direction. Another notable patent is "Decorative light guide as high-speed optical interconnect." This patent describes a method of using a plastic decorative light guide in vehicles as a high-speed optical interconnect, enhancing optical communication through innovative design.
